| Project Type |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Partial kitchen demolition | $1,200 - $4,000 |
| Full kitchen demolition | $7,000 - $12,000 |
| Cabinet removal | $2,000 - $4,000 |
| Countertop removal | $1,500 - $3,000 |
| Flooring removal | $1,000 - $3,500 |
| Wall removal | $2,000 - $5,000 |
| Electrical & plumbing disconnection | $1,500 - $3,500 |

Project Size and Scope
| Scope/Size |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Partial Kitchen Demolition (e.g., cabinets, countertops) | $1,500 - $4,000 |
| Full Kitchen Demolition (including cabinets, appliances, flooring) | $4,000 - $10,000 |
| Removal of built-in appliances and fixtures | $500 - $2,000 |
| Disposal and debris removal | Included in demolition costs or $300 - $800 separately |
| Structural modifications or repairs | Varies widely depending on scope |
